Dental implants have become a preferred answer for these seeking to replace missing teeth. The journey to getting dental implants begins with consultations and evaluations, where your dentist will assess your Recommended Site oral health, bone density, and general suitability for the procedure. Understanding what to anticipate throughout dental implant surgery may help calm any link anxiety you may feel.


On the day of the procedure, you will arrive at the dental workplace, the place you'll be greeted and prepared for surgery. Implants Dental Procedure Wyoming MI. It’s frequent for a neighborhood anesthetic to be administered to ensure you stay snug throughout the surgery. Some practitioners may offer sedation choices to assist alleviate any fears or anxieties you might have. It’s essential to debate sedation methods beforehand to find out what suits you best


Once you are comfortably settled, the dentist will start the surgery. The first step sometimes involves making a small incision in the gum tissue to reveal the underlying bone. This is completed to organize the site for the implant. After exposing the bone, the dentist will create a space during which the implant shall be placed.

The dental implant itself resembles a small post, typically manufactured from titanium, which is known for its power and biocompatibility. This submit is fastidiously inserted into the prepared site. The course of requires precision, because the implant must be placed at an angle conducive to the abutment and crown that will comply with.


After the implant is securely positioned, the gum tissue is closed round it. In some circumstances, a quick lived crown might be placed on prime to offer aesthetic worth whereas your mouth heals. Following the process, it's common to experience some swelling, discomfort, or minor bleeding, which are all a half of the natural therapeutic course of.


In the times and weeks following the surgery, osseointegration begins, which is the method where the bone heals around the implant, firmly anchoring it in place. This healing course of can take a quantity of months, throughout which the dental workplace will schedule follow-up visits to monitor your progress. You might also experience changes in your diet, as soft foods are often beneficial throughout recovery.


It's essential to comply with your dentist’s post-operative care directions in the course of the therapeutic phase. Maintaining good oral hygiene is vital, but care must be taken not to disrupt the surgical site. Your dentist will provide detailed cleaning directions, which can contain light rinsing and avoiding areas instantly across the implant initially.

If you had bone grafting performed in the course of the initial surgery to make sure there’s enough bone for the implant, it'd delay the healing interval. This follow-up usually includes finding out the bone integration through X-rays before transferring on to the next levels


Once the therapeutic period is over, the dentist will schedule one other appointment to put the abutment on the implant. This abutment will serve as a connector for the custom-made crown that can complete your implant-supported restoration. During this go to, the dentist can also take impressions of your mouth for the crown design.


When the crown is ready, a last fitting appointment will happen. The dentist will position the crown onto the abutment whereas ensuring perfect alignment along with your existing teeth. Making any essential adjustments at this stage is essential for comfort and aesthetics.

Will I be awake during the procedure?undefinedMost sufferers obtain native anesthesia to numb the area, permitting them to remain awake without feeling pain. Some may opt for sedation choices to help them chill out. Always discuss your preferences with your dentist earlier than surgery.


How long does the recovery time take after dental implant surgery?undefinedRecovery time varies between individuals, but preliminary healing often takes about 1 to 2 weeks. Full integration of the implant into the jawbone can take a number of months. During this time, regular follow-ups along with your dentist are essential to watch therapeutic.


What kind of pain or discomfort can I anticipate post-surgery?undefinedMild pain and swelling are frequent after surgery, which can sometimes be managed with prescribed pain treatment and ice packs. Most discomfort subsides within a few days, and your dentist will present specific instructions to assist ease any pain.
